About

NASB Financial, Inc. operates as a holding company for North American Savings Bank, F.S.B. and Nor-Am Service Corporation that provides various banking products and services in the United States. The company offers demand deposit, savings, money market, and certificate of deposit accounts, as well as brokered accounts. NASB Financial Inc (NASB) - Total Liabilities

Latest total liabilities as of December 2025: $2.53 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, NASB Financial Inc (NASB) has total liabilities worth $2.53 Billion USD as of December 2025.

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.
